cuniculus, Hoplolatilus Randall [J. E.] & Dooley [J. K.] 1974:466, Figs. 1D, 9 [Copeia 1974 (no. 2); ref. 5336] Edge of pass, Papara, off Popote Bay, Tahiti, Society Islands [French Polynesia, South Pacific], depth 36-45 meters. Holotype: BPBM 11996. Paratypes: AMS I.17155-001; BMNH 1973.7.17.2 (1); BPBM 9281 (2), 11997 (4); CAS 28354 (1); MNHN 1973-0035 (1); USNM 209534 (1 or 9). Type catalog: Bauchot & Desoutter 1989:22 [ref. 15502]. •Valid as Hoplolatilus cuniculus Randall & Dooley 1974 -- (Dooley 1978:66 [ref. 5499], Araga in Masuda et al. 1984:152 [ref. 6441], Paxton et al. 1989:566 [ref. 12442], Randall et al. 1990:154 [ref. 15987], Earle & Pyle 1997:382 [ref. 22771], Allen 1997:130 [ref. 23977], Randall et al. 1997:154 [ref. 25919], Anderson et al. 1998:24 [ref. 23611], Myers 1999:134 [ref. 23965], Fricke 1999:237 [ref. 24106], Dooley 1999:2640 [ref. 24837], Nakabo 2000:785 [ref. 25086], Dooley in Randall & Lim 2000:615 [ref. 25122], Laboute & Grandperrin 2000:221 [ref. 25191], Nakabo 2002:785 [ref. 26001], Allen & Adrim 2003:37 [ref. 26830], Manilo & Bogorodsky 2003:S106 [ref. 27377], Randall et al. 2004:15 [ref. 27624], Randall 2005:217 [ref. 28239], Paxton et al. 2006:1128 [ref. 28995], Allen 2007:105 [ref. 29223], Allen et al. 2010:172 [ref. 30989], Motomura et al. 2010:114 [ref. 31256], Allen & Erdmann 2012:420 [ref. 31980], Fricke et al. 2018:177 [ref. 35805], Dooley 2022:379 [ref. 39861], Mulochau et al. 2022:268 [ref. 39073]). Current status: Valid as Hoplolatilus cuniculus Randall & Dooley 1974. Malacanthidae. Distribution: Indo-West Pacific: KwaZulu-Natal (South Africa), East Africa, Madagascar and western Mascarenes (La RĂ©union, Mauritius) east to Marshall Islands and Society Islands (French Polynesia), north to Ryukyu Islands (Japan), south to Queensland (Australia), New Caledonia and Tonga. Habitat: marine.
